At Handmade in the Hunter Markets, you'll discover a wide range of products crafted by local artisans, each one reflecting its maker's unique skills and passion.

 

For more than 12 years, the markets have been a favourite destination for both locals and visitors. Every stall offers something unique, creating a vibrant experience and ensuring there's always a reason to come back. While you're there, take the opportunity to pick up wine or picnic goodies amidst the charming rose-lined gardens of Sobels Wines. The markets are open from 9am to 2pm, with upcoming dates on Saturdays, 15, 22 and 29 March and 5, 12, 19, and Sunday 20 April. Plenty of parking is available, pets on leashes are welcome, and all vendors accept EFTPOS. For more information, visit www.handmadehuntermarkets.com.au
